Von: John Johansen [mailto:john.johansen () canonical com] Betreff: [oss-security] CVE Request: Linux kernel: privilege escalation in user namespaces Hi, I haven't seen CVE request for this one yet so, Jann Horn reported a privilege escalation in user namespaces to the lkml mailing list https://lkml.org/lkml/2015/12/12/259 if a root-owned process wants to enter a user namespace for some reason without knowing who owns it and therefore can't change to the namespace owner's uid and gid before entering, as soon as it has entered the namespace, the namespace owner can attach to it via ptrace and thereby gain access to its uid and gid.
Could it be, that this is identical to https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/lxc/+bug/1475050 which led to https://bugs.launchpad.net/bugs/cve/2015-1334 except, that combined with another timerace, this gives host uid 0 escalation no matter how the target namespace looks like or target uid is known or not? The bug is marked as fixed, but looking at it, the very similar kernel issue seems not be addressed and it is also still marked "private security" although fix was released.
